Transition metal complex of the general formula [1]: where m is a transition metal atom of the group consisting of 4 of the periodic table; a is an atom from the group 16 is therein; j is an atom from the group 14 is therein; r1, R2, R3, R4, R5, R6, X1 and x2 independently of one another are (1) a substituent selected from the group consisting of (1 - 1) an alkyl radical having 1 to 20 carbon atoms, which may be substituted with a halogen atom (1 - 2) an aralkyl radical having 7 to 20 carbon atoms, which may be substituted with a halogen atom (1 - 3) an aryl radical having 6 to 20 carbon atoms, which may be substituted with a halogen atom (1 - 4) a a substituent having silyl group with 1 to 20 carbon atoms, wherein the substituent is a hydrocarbon residue and the hydrocarbon radical may be substituted with a halogen atom (1 - 5) having a disubstitution amino radical with 2 to 20 carbon atoms, wherein the substituent is a hydrocarbon residue and the hydrocarbon radical may be substituted with a halogen atom (1 - 6) an alkoxy radical..
